合聚咖

合聚咖

金融编程需要学什么

admin

金融编程需要学习的主要内容有:编程语言、金融理论、数据分析与统计、金融市场的技术分析和交易策略。

接下来详细解释金融编程所需掌握的知识体系:

编程语言。金融编程涉及大量的编程工作,通常需要掌握至少一种编程语言,如Python、Java等。这些语言在金融领域广泛应用,用于数据处理、模型构建和算法交易等。

金融理论。了解基本的金融概念和理论对于金融编程至关重要。这包括金融市场的基本原理、投资组合理论、风险管理等。这些知识能够帮助程序员更好地理解金融市场的运作机制,为编程工作提供理论基础。

数据分析与统计。金融编程中大量的工作涉及数据分析与统计,需要掌握相关的方法和工具,如回归分析、时间序列分析等。此外,还需要熟练使用数据处理软件如Excel,以及统计分析工具如R语言和Python中的相关库。

金融市场的技术分析和交易策略。金融市场技术分析帮助预测市场趋势,而交易策略则是基于这些预测制定交易计划。金融编程人员需要了解这些分析方法和策略,以便在编程过程中实现自动化交易和风险管理功能。

此外,金融编程可能还需要对数据库管理、网络安全、云计算等领域有所了解。随着金融科技的发展,这些技能对于金融编程人员来说也越来越重要。总的来说,金融编程需要掌握综合性的知识体系,并紧跟市场动态和最新技术发展。通过学习上述知识领域和实践经验积累,可以更好地从事金融编程工作并不断进步。